If the cells are added in series, then the terminal voltage will increase, as would the internal resistance. If they are added in parallel, then the voltage would remain the same as for one cell, but the internal resistance would fall, and the available charge (in ampere hours) would increase.

When connecting cells in parallel, it is important that they are all of the same type. The total e.m.f. of cells connected in parallel is equal the the e.m.f. of an individual cell. So, if each cell has an e.m.f. of, say, 1.5 V, then it doesn't matter whether you have one cell or a hundred cells, the e.m.f. of the resulting battery will also be 1.5 V.
